  • I have Windows Vista Home Premium 32 bit and I get this "TCP/IP ping command has stopped working" how to fix this?

    I have Windows Vista Home Premium 32 bit and I get this pop windows window advising me "TCP/IP Ping command has stopped working". I click on "check online for a solution", but there is no charge and disappear. I still have the problem, and it's very irritating. How can I remedy outside junking my Tower and buy another?  Thanks for any help on this.

    Hello

    1 did you change on your computer before this problem?

    2. when exactly you receive error message?

    You can follow the methods and see if it helps.

    Method 1
    Use the PING command to verify that TCP/IP is working properly. To do this, ping the loopback address (127.0.0.1) by typing the following command at a command prompt:
    (a) click Start .
    (b) in the search box type command prompt.
    (c) right-click and select run as administrator of .
    (d) type ping 127.0.0.1 and ENTRY.
    If you receive the response of 127.0.0.1, it means that TCP/IP is configured correctly.

    Method 2
    Check to see if the problem exists in safe mode with network.

    Start your computer in safe mode
    http://Windows.Microsoft.com/en-us/Windows-Vista/start-your-computer-in-safe-mode

    Method 3:

    Alternatively, you can try to reset TCP/IP and then check if it helps:


    How to reset the Protocol Internet (TCP/IP)
    http://support.Microsoft.com/kb/299357

    Method 4:

    I also suggest you to download and run the latest Microsoft Scanner on your computer and check to see if it helps:

    http://www.Microsoft.com/security/scanner/en-us/default.aspx

    Note: The data files that are infected must be cleaned only by removing the file completely, which means that there is a risk of data loss.

  • How to get a windows Vista Home Premium 32-bit installation disc?

    My computer is an emachine T5086.  It has Windows Vista Home Premium and when loading drivers they stop loading at "windows32 drivers/crcdisk sys. I don't know what that means.

    Then, the computer restarts and asks me to install my windows installation disc for repairs.  F8 on reboot is not available as an option.  I don't have a repair option I turn on the computer and hold down the F8 key manually.  I don't have a windows disk or recovery disk and I can't to where I can find a restore either point.

    How to make a windows Vista Home Premium 32-bit installation disk?  I have my product key. Or where can I get one?

    Hello

    There are different methods to reinstall Vista.

    There is no Windows Vista downloads available from Microsoft.

    You can contact the manufacturer of your computer, eMachines and ask them to send you a set of recovery disks.

    They should do this for a small fee.

    http://www.eMachines.com/EC/en/us/content/home

    To reinstall Vista using their recovery disk/s, you start from the 1st recovery disk they provide and follow the manufacturer's instructions to reinstall:

    You need to change the Boot order to make the DVD/CD drive 1st in the boot order:

    How to change the Boot order in BIOS:

    http://pcsupport.about.com/od/fixtheproblem/SS/bootorderchange.htm

    "How to replace Microsoft software or hardware, order service packs and replace product manuals.

    http://support.Microsoft.com/kb/326246

    And if you have never received a recovery disk when you bought your computer, there should be a recovery Partition on the hard drive to reinstall Vista on how you purchased your computer.

    The recovery process can be started by pressing a particular combination of the key or keys at startup. (Power on / start)

    Maybe it's F10, F11, Alt + F10, etc., depending on the manufacturer.

    Ask them to the proper key sequence.

    Some manufacturers have more available Vista recovery disks.

    If this happens, you may need to try this instead:

    You can also borrow and use a Microsoft Vista DVD, which contains the files for the different editions of Vista (Home Basic, Home Premium, Business and Ultimate) must be installed. The product key on your computer / Laptop box determines what Edition is installed.

    Other manufacturers recovery DVDs are should not be used for this purpose.

    And you need to know the version of 'bit' for Vista, as 32-bit and 64-bit editions come on different DVDs

    Here's how to do a clean install of Vista using a DVD of Vista from Microsoft:

    "How to do a clean install and configure with a full Version of Vista '

    http://www.Vistax64.com/tutorials/117366-clean-install-full-version-Vista.html

    And once the operating system is installed, go to your computer manufacturer's website and get the latest drivers for your particular model or laptop computer.

    And phone Activation may be necessary when you use the above installation method.

    "How to activate Vista normally and by Activation of the phone '

    http://www.Vistax64.com/tutorials/84488-activate-Vista-phone.html

    See you soon.
